1. Classic Layered Cake with Pixelated Icing
The Classic Layered Cake stays true to the appearance of a real birthday cake while embracing Minecraft’s blocky style.

Use white concrete, quartz, and pink wool to create thick icing layers. Add decorative candles using end rods and colorful blocks.
This design works beautifully as the central attraction of any birthday party build.
Simple, recognizable, and timeless.
2. Creeper Face Cake
A Creeper Face Cake instantly tells guests that the celebration is Minecraft-themed.

Construct a square cake using green concrete, lime wool, and black blocks to recreate the Creeper’s iconic face. Add frosting details around the edges for a realistic cake appearance.
It’s one of the most recognizable Minecraft birthday designs.
3. TNT Block Cake
For players who love explosions, a TNT Block Cake is the perfect choice.

Build a giant cake shaped like a TNT block using red concrete, white wool, and black detailing. Add candles or fireworks nearby for extra excitement.
This cake is playful, bold, and full of Minecraft personality.
4. Diamond Sword Cake
Turn one of Minecraft’s most legendary items into a cake.

Create a large rectangular cake base and place a giant pixelated Diamond Sword rising from the center. Use diamond blocks, cyan concrete, and gray blocks to replicate the weapon.
This design feels heroic and instantly catches attention.
5. Steve Head Cake
Celebrate Minecraft’s iconic character with a Steve-inspired cake.

Build a cube-shaped cake featuring Steve’s pixelated face on all sides. Use colored concrete blocks to recreate his signature appearance.
This cake serves as both a decoration and a tribute to Minecraft’s classic hero.
6. Multi-Tier Grass Block Cake
Combine traditional birthday cake aesthetics with Minecraft’s most recognizable block.

Stack several tiers shaped like grass blocks using dirt-colored and green blocks. Add decorative icing layers between each level.
The layered appearance makes the cake look both realistic and uniquely Minecraft-inspired.
7. Nether Portal Cake
A Nether Portal Cake creates a dramatic centerpiece.

Build a rectangular obsidian frame filled with purple stained glass or glowing purple blocks. Surround it with cake layers and decorative frosting.
The glowing portal effect makes this cake especially impressive during nighttime celebrations.
8. Cake-within-a-Cake (In-Game Cake Block)
This fun design celebrates Minecraft’s original cake block.

Build a giant version of the standard Minecraft cake and place actual cake blocks on top as decorations. The playful concept creates a cake inside a cake.
Guests instantly recognize the reference.
It’s simple but highly creative.
9. Villager Face Cake
A Villager Face Cake adds humor and charm to your party.

Use beige, brown, and green blocks to recreate a villager’s face complete with its famous nose and eyebrows. Add decorative frosting around the edges.
This cake often becomes a favorite conversation piece.
10. Enderman Tall Cake
The Enderman Tall Cake stands out because of its unique vertical design.

Create a towering black cake with glowing purple eyes and decorative end-themed details. Use obsidian, black concrete, and purple lighting effects.
The unusual height makes it an impressive centerpiece.
11. Pixelated Number Cake
Celebrate a specific birthday age with a giant number cake.

Build the birthday number using colorful blocks and frosting details. Surround it with candles, balloons, and festive decorations.
This cake personalizes the celebration and makes great screenshots.
12. Enchanted Table Cake
Inspired by one of Minecraft’s most magical blocks, this cake feels mystical and elegant.

Use bookshelves, dark blocks, and glowing accents to recreate an enchanting table appearance. Add cake layers and decorative candles around the structure.
The magical theme creates a unique birthday centerpiece.
13. Bee Cake
Bee-themed builds remain incredibly popular.

Construct a cute bee-shaped cake using yellow, black, and white blocks. Add tiny wings and flower decorations around the base.
This design feels cheerful, colorful, and fun.
14. Axolotl Cake
The adorable Axolotl deserves its own birthday cake.

Use pink concrete, white blocks, and decorative fins to create a giant axolotl face. Add water-themed decorations nearby.
The cute appearance makes this one of the most lovable cake designs.
15. Amethyst Geode Cake
An Amethyst Geode Cake combines elegance and fantasy.

Build a cake featuring purple crystal formations emerging from the center. Use amethyst blocks, stained glass, and glowing accents.
The sparkling effect makes the cake feel luxurious and magical.
16. Lantern Cake
Lighting becomes part of the decoration with a Lantern Cake.

Construct a cake designed around a giant lantern structure using copper, chains, and glowing blocks. Surround it with festive party decorations.
The warm lighting creates a cozy atmosphere.
17. Redstone Cake
Perfect for engineers and technical Minecraft players.

Decorate the cake using redstone dust patterns, repeaters, and redstone-inspired color schemes. Add glowing redstone lamps for extra visual interest.
The design celebrates Minecraft’s technical side.
18. Oak Wood Planks Cake
For rustic-themed birthday parties, try an Oak Wood Planks Cake.

Use oak planks, stripped logs, and wooden textures to create a cake that resembles a handcrafted woodland dessert. Add lanterns and flowers nearby.
The natural look feels warm and inviting.
19. Birthday Sign Cake
Finish your celebration with a personalized Birthday Sign Cake.

Build a large cake with the birthday person’s name or a birthday message displayed on top using colorful blocks. Add candles, banners, and fireworks around the structure.
This design creates a memorable centerpiece for special occasions.
Tips for Building the Perfect Minecraft Birthday Cake
Use Bright Colors
Colorful blocks make birthday cakes feel festive and exciting.
Add Candles
End rods, lanterns, and custom lighting can simulate birthday candles.
Build on a Large Scale
Oversized cakes become impressive focal points for party builds.
Include Party Decorations
Banners, balloons, fireworks, and seating areas help complete the celebration.
Use Lighting Effects
Glowstone, sea lanterns, and shroomlights make cakes stand out at night.
Personalize the Design
Adding names, ages, or favorite Minecraft mobs makes the cake more meaningful.

FAQs
What is the easiest Minecraft birthday cake to build?
The Classic Layered Cake and Pixelated Number Cake are beginner-friendly designs that require simple materials and shapes.
Which Minecraft cake design is most popular?
Creeper Face Cakes, TNT Cakes, and Steve Head Cakes are among the most recognizable and widely used designs.
Can I build birthday cakes in survival mode?
Yes. Most cake designs can be built using survival-friendly materials, though larger versions may require additional resource gathering.
How can I make my cake look more realistic?
Use multiple layers, contrasting icing colors, decorative candles, and detailed frosting patterns.
What decorations go well with Minecraft birthday cakes?
Banners, lanterns, fireworks, balloons, party tables, and themed statues all complement birthday cake builds.
Are giant cakes good for multiplayer servers?
Absolutely. Large birthday cakes make excellent gathering points and photo locations during server events.
